If you are looking for work – or looking for workers – CareerForce can help you.
Call or email us to set up a time to talk through what you need and resources available to help you. Our contact info is below the map. Or make an appointment below by selecting a Job Search Appointment time that works for you.
If you prefer to stop by our office, please call ahead so you get the help you need. View our office hours below the map.
All CareerForce services are provided free of charge to all customers, including Minnesota businesses.
Some specific services provided at this location:
CareerForce is the State of Minnesota’s official career exploration and job search resource.

If you have an injury or illness that is affecting your ability to work, Minnesota’s RETAIN program is here to assist you.
We want you to be successful developing in-demand skills, finding employment in an in-demand, high-growth field and securing long-term family-sustaining wages.
You proudly served our country, and now we’re proud to serve you. CareerForce specialists are ready to empower veterans and active-duty military members to secure successful civilian careers.

If you’ve lost your job through no fault of your own, or if you meet other eligibility requirements, we’d like to help you return to work.

Whether you’re looking for your first job or the next great opportunity, CareerForce is your starting point. Our specialists are available to provide career coaching, share local employment information or refer you to customized resources.
